CUSTOMS RETURNS.

PORT OF NEW PLYMOUTH. We are indebted to Mr. J. H. Hempton for the following list of Customs duties collected at the port of New Plymouth for the month of June, 1913 £ s. dSpirits 1184 10 7 rio-ars and snuff 24 0 10 Sirettes 500 18 9 ncco (manufactured) ... 1091 11 3 Wines— Sparkling 4 10 0 Australian 13 15 6 Other kinds 41 S 1 South African 1 5 10 Ale and beer 20 0 0 Chicory, cocoa and chocolate— General tariff 13 5 0 Preferential tariff ......... 310 Goods by weight— General tariff 161 4 2 Preferential tariff 4 2 10 Ad valorem — General tariff .............. 578 18,10 Preferential tariff 25 5 6 Other duties— General tariff 57 T 4 9 Preferential tariff 0 18 4 General tariff 3693 I‘4 9, Preferential tariff '. .33',-7 8 South African ; 1 5 10 Total £3728 8 3 Tho excise duty for the month amounted to £69 7s. Tho Customs duties for the corresponding mouth of last year amounted to £3125 11s Id, and the excise duty to £57 9s.
